Key Replacement for Cars: A Comprehensive Guide
Losing or damaging a car key can be a frustrating experience. For lots of, the idea of replacing a car key frequently brings to mind different expenses, time periods, and procedures that can quickly end up being overwhelming. This guide aims to inform car owners about the types of keys, the replacement procedure, expenses, and frequently asked questions to help browse the key replacement journey successfully.
Types of Car Keys
Comprehending the type of car key you possess is important when seeking replacements. Here are the typical kinds of car keys available today:
Type of Key | Description | Typical Cars |
---|---|---|
Standard Key | An easy metal key without any electronics | Older models, a lot of basic cars |
Transponder Key | A key with a chip that interacts with the car's ignition | Most mid-range and newer cars |
Remote Key Fob | A key with a remote control function, often used for locking/unlocking | Common in modern-day lorries |
Smart Key | A distance key that permits push-button start without inserting the key | High-end brand names and hybrids |
Understanding the Differences
Traditional Keys: Often the least costly to replace, conventional keys can typically be replicated by any locksmith.
Transponder Keys: These keys work with your car's ignition system. A replacement needs programming to sync with the vehicle, which may include going to a dealer or specialized locksmith professional.
Remote Key Fobs: In addition to unlocking the doors, these keys can also include functions like a panic button or trunk release. They normally require replacement and shows from a dealership or a specialized key maker.
Smart Keys: Smart keys add an additional layer of technology, permitting for keyless entry and start. Changing these can often be the most intricate and pricey due to the sophisticated innovation included.
The Key Replacement Process
Changing a car key is not as uncomplicated as just getting a copy at the nearby hardware store, especially for transponder keys, remote fobs, and wise keys. The steps generally include:
Identifying the Type of Key: Determine what type of key your vehicle utilizes.
Gathering Necessary Information: To replace your key, you may need:
- The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)
- Proof of ownership (title, registration)
- A valid ID
Choosing a Replacement Option: There are several opportunities to check out:
- Dealership: Often the most costly option, however makes sure proper shows.
- Independent Locksmith: Can typically deal with transponder keys and fobs at a lower expense.
- Online Services: Some business offer cutting and setting services by means of mail but validate they're reputable to prevent rip-offs.
Programming the Key: The brand-new key should be set to deal with your vehicle's immobilizer and other electronic systems.
Testing the Key: Once the key is replaced and set, guarantee it works properly with all elements of the vehicle.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What should I do if I lose my car key?
If you lose your car key, very first check for a spare. If unavailable, find your vehicle's VIN and evidence of ownership, and contact a dealer or locksmith professional for a replacement.
2. Can I replace my own car key?
While some basic keys can be replaced in the house, the majority of modern-day keys need specialized programs that a dealer or locksmith should perform.
3. For how long does it require to replace a car key?
The time frame for replacing a car key can vary from 30 minutes to several hours, depending on the kind of key and the process required for programming.
4. Are key replacement services offered 24/7?
Numerous locksmith professionals use 24/7 services, especially for emergency scenarios. Nevertheless, availability may differ, so it's wise to inspect in advance.
5. Can I get a duplicate without the initial key?
For traditional keys, yes. Nevertheless, for transponder keys and clever keys, having the initial is typically required for proper programs.
